Common questions about Лоризан (FAQ)
Q: How quickly can I expect to feel the effect of Лоризан after taking it?
According to the official product information, the primary anti-allergy effect typically begins within one to three hours after the medicine is administered. The maximal effect is generally reached between eight and twelve hours. This indicates that the medicine is not designed to provide immediate relief.
Q: How long does it take for the active substance of Лоризан to be eliminated from the body?
Pharmacokinetic studies indicate that the mean elimination half-life is approximately 8.4 hours for the main substance, Loratadine. The active metabolite has a longer half-life of about 28 hours. Official data states that around 80% of the dose is typically eliminated from the body within ten days.

Q: Does Лоризан affect memory or concentration skills?
Clinical studies indicate that when taken as directed, the medicine does not significantly impair psychomotor function, memory, or concentration. This is related to its classification as a non-sedating, second-generation antihistamine.
Q: Does the body develop tolerance to the effects of Лоризан over time?
Studies examining the medicine's activity have shown no evidence that the body develops tolerance to the antihistaminic effect after 28 days of continuous dosing. The body continues to respond to the medicine's intended action.

Q: Is it necessary to avoid grapefruit juice while taking this medicine?
Regulatory sources indicate that grapefruit juice may increase the blood levels of the medicine. This happens because the juice can interfere with a specific enzyme that is responsible for breaking the medicine down in the body.
Q: Are there warnings about combining Лоризан with antidepressant medication?
The medicine may interact with certain drugs, including some antidepressants. Official reports specifically note that the antidepressant Fluoxetine can reduce the liver metabolism of this medicine, potentially increasing its blood levels.
